77. Vitali Grigoryev (Russian, born 1957)
Still life with acorns. Oil on canvas, framed, signed. Image size approx. 15-3/4" x 17-3/4", framed overall approx. 25" x 26-1/2". A fascinating photo-realist still life painting, done with meticulous attention to detail.

79. Alexander Fjodorow (Russian, born 1965)
"Purple Flowers". Oil on canvas, signed in the lower right corner. Dates 2002. Canvas measures approx. 24" x 30"; in a gilt wood frame approx. 32" x 38". Alexander was born in 1965 in the town of Cheboksary. In 1993 he graduated from the St. Petersburg Art Academy. In January 21, 2001 he was awarded by the President Vladimir Putin with a grant from a Cultural Fund. Fjodorov held personal exhibitions in Russia and Europe.

81. Leonid Fedorovich Ovsiannikov (Russian, ca. 1893/5 - 1972)
Vladimir Ilich Lenin. Etching, signed A. Ovsiannikov within the image lower left, dated 1933. Not framed, image measures approx. 8-3/8" x 6-1/2"; overall paper measures approx. 14-1/4" x 12-1/4". Leonid Fedorovich Ovsiannikov was a professor at Leningrad Art Academy, famous Russian/Soviet graphic artist, a master of graphic portrait. His portraits of Lenin and Stalin are in the collections of Tretyakovskaya Gallery and Russian Museum.

82. A Large Brass Samovar & Tray, Russian, ca. early 20th Century
The body of the urn has two handles with turned wooden inserts and a spigot. The tray is key-hole in shape with a flared rim. The urn has stamped designs on the front above the spigot which resemble coins and a shield shape surmounted by a bird with the wings spread. The overall height is 20", with the tray, 19" x 13" overall. Provenance: Ex Collection of the Women's City Club, Cleveland, Ohio.
